The Castle of Castelnaud la Chapelle
Ranked among the Most Beautiful Villages in France, Castelnaud la Chapelle takes you through time to return to the Middle Ages. Its medieval castle is a must-see site in the region. In season, the castle offers numerous activities such as trebuchet shooting and swordsmanship. The castle can be discovered all year round.

The Castle of Milandes
Between castle, gardens and bird show just a few minutes from the Domaine de Monrecour, let yourself be carried away by the Château des Milandes and the incredible story of the talented Joséphine Baker who was once the mistress of the place. This mythical place can be discovered from March to January. A stroll to the market
To discover products from Périgord Noir such as truffles, walnuts, strawberries and duck in all their forms, nothing beats a farmers' market. The Sarlat market is one of the largest in the region and welcomes you on Saturday morning and Wednesday morning in season. The Saint-Cyprien market welcomes you on Sunday morning.
Beynac Castle
Linked by history to the Domaine de Monrecour and by its proximity, the Château de Beynac will allow you to cross 5 centuries of history as a castle in the heart of Périgord Noir. Perched at the top of the village of Beynac, the castle offers a beautiful view of the Dordogne valley. Open all year
